以“VMware应用现代化解决方案”为主题,日前VMware大中华区战略发展副总裁 李映博士、VMware大中华区高级产品经理傅纯一接受了记者的线上专访。
专访首先提到了应用的现代化。什么是应用现代化呢?我们如何转型才能够既构建现代应用,又可以继续使用现有的应用?我们如何借助现代基础架构提高效率和多云可移植性呢?
李映博士透露:现代应用并不是VMware新包装的概念,它是VMware与国外用户交流中,讨论并归纳的结果:现代化应用是一种弹性的、支持多云的微服务架构,由虚拟机、容器和无服务器功能的协调发布组成。
简单说:可以把现代应用理解为微服务架构的应用。
用户现在的应用不是微服务架构的,而是一种单体应用的架构。二者最大的差别在于:敏捷性。体现在对于业务需求的快速响应能力,以及IT基础设施资源调配的效率上。以互联网和传统企业的对比为例:传统企业信息系统更新以年计,相比之下,互联网企业的应用一天就可能发生数次迭代。
对于传统企业来说,应用开发和运维是割裂的,从开发环境到生产环境稳定使用需要经历一个漫长的过程。因此,敏捷应用开发和运维也是迫切需要解决的问题。
所有这些问题的答案只有一个就是:微服务架构的应用,所谓现代化应用。
实际上,也没有必要纠结现代化应用。对于用户来说, VMware Tanzu和vSphere 7才是更应该引起关注的解决方案及技术产品,这才是迈向应用现代化的第一步。
对于用户来说,
在《大结局:容器还是虚拟机?争论画上“休止符”》一文中,已经介绍了VMware Tanzu的首款产品Tanzu Mission Control,能够帮助用户管理任意地点运行的全部Kubernetes集群,简单说就是解决了容器集群的管理问题,如容器生命周期管理、备份及恢复、配置控制,以及访问控制等。
与那时相比,Tanzu产品家族进一步扩大,已经扩展到了7款主要产品。
不同产品针对不同的问题,需要用户付费购买。
VMware Tanzu这些产品涉及到云原生应用开发框架、应用容器化、软件到安全的自动化平台、跨云环境的K8S运维,以及多集群运维环境的统一和优化。
简单一句话,针对微服务化的云原生应用,以及虚拟机等计算资源的管理,Tanzu拥有各式各样有针对性的管理工具。
与之相比,正式投放使用的VMware vSphere 7,被VMware称为十年来vSphere最大的演进,其重点在于采用K8S API开放平台的重构,可以为开发人员和运维人员提供类似云的体验。
vSphere 7集简化的生命周期管理、原生安全性、应用加速、容器应用和管理等功能于一身,一方面强化DRS、vMotion增强以及对持久内存(PMEM)功能的支持,利用GPU弹性资源池提高利用率;另一方面强化虚拟机、容器工作负载的集中管控,提升开发人员的效率。
如今,微服务化如日中天,但是对于用户来说,微服务化没有办法一蹴而就,用户需要在新与旧、传统与现代之间徘徊,特别多云更增加了事物的复杂性,这也是感觉棘手的问题。
VMware Tanzu 和vSphere 7的出现,让这些棘手的问题迎刃而解。就像一台时间机器,用户得以自由的穿梭。
这样的“时间机器”能够得到用户的青睐吗?